Fingerprint Spoofing Capabilities



A crucial aspect of anti-detect browsers is fingerprint spoofing. Both Incogniton and Undetectable excel at masking your fingerprint, making it appear like you’re using different devices and browsers from diverse locations. This helps prevent websites from identifying and potentially blocking your multiple accounts.



However, they achieve this in entirely different ways. Incogniton offers a cloud-first approach where you retain a set of customized parameters of browser fingerprint for each of your profiles.



Undetectable offers two settings: ‘configs’ and then ‘real fingerprints.’ The ‘configs’ are the fingerprints you can tweak and adjust to your preference and localized to your device. However, you have to purchase ‘real fingerprints’ if you want them.



Profile Management



When it comes to profile management, the two platforms have distinct approaches.



Incogniton prioritizes a balance with a capped number of profiles on all paid plans. This caters well to smaller teams or individuals who don’t require a vast number of accounts.



Undetectable.io shines for those needing ultimate flexibility. It offers unlimited local profiles on paid plans, making it ideal for large-scale operations. However, keep in mind that managing a significant number of profiles comes with its own set of challenges, such as increased resource requirements and potential organizational hurdles and there is no cloud saving, which Incogniton does have, meaning data cannot be synced between devices.



Ease of Use



Undetectable’s user interface is pretty dense with a lot of menus and configurations to attend to. The browser looks to be designed for tech-savvy users who can navigate a lot of technicalities to get what they want. Every button you click pops up a separate menu display for you to choose from.



On the other hand, Incogniton’s interface is quite simplified. The first display is sectioned into specific profiles you have created so that you can get started as soon as possible. The Side Navigation bar includes all the settings you can tweak to customize your experience if you need to, at any time.



For new users, you get to customize everything you need right from the profile creation page. You won’t be directed to multiple menus and pages.



Incogniton is geared towards helping you get your task done faster while Undetectable presents you with lots of options to choose from. Both approaches have their pros and cons, however, it all depends on which one aligns better with your technical comfort level.



Pricing and Value for Money



Both Incogniton and Undetectable.io offer free trials, allowing you to test their features before committing. However, the number of profiles you can manage in the free tier differs significantly.



Incogniton boasts a generous free plan with 10 profiles, while Undetectable.io limits you to just 5 profiles. For those dipping their toes into the world of anti-detect browsers or those requiring a larger number of accounts right off the bat, Incogniton offers a more accessible entry point and a clear advantage.



In terms of pricing, Incogniton generally falls on the more budget-friendly side compared to Undetectable.io. While both offer tiered pricing plans, Incogniton’s packages tend to be more affordable for the same number of profiles.



Additional Features and Automation Capabilities



Automation plays a crucial role in managing multiple accounts efficiently. Both platforms offer robust automation tools, allowing you to schedule tasks and streamline workflows. This can be extremely beneficial for tasks like social media posting or data scraping that have repetitive elements to them.



Both Incogniton and Undetectable offer several additional features to enhance your browsing experience:



  • Cookie Collector feature: Capture and store cookies from specific websites for later use in different profiles.
  • Bulk Profile Creator: Create multiple browsing profiles at once.
  • Integration with automation libraries like Selenium and Puppeteer: Create custom scripts for automating tasks in your workflow.



However, Incogniton offers an added advantage with its Synchronizer feature — a feature that lets you synchronize specific browsing data across profiles, mimicking natural user behavior and further enhancing the legitimacy of your virtual environments.



Location, Data Safety, and User Trust



Security is paramount when managing multiple online accounts. Both Incogniton and Undetectable.io, based in Europe, provide peace of mind regarding data privacy regulations due to the region’s stringent data protection laws (GDPR). Incogniton is headquartered in the Netherlands, while Undetectable.io is based in Cyprus.



However, user reviews on Trustpilot paint a slightly different picture. Incogniton boasts a more positive rating of 4.8 compared to Undetectable.io’s 3.6 on a 5-star rating. While user reviews should not be the sole factor in your decision, they can provide valuable insights into customer experiences.
